Channels


Retail Stores: Rocky Mountain Chocolate Factory, Inc. operates company-owned retail stores as well as franchise-operated stores. The company-owned retail stores are strategically located in high-traffic areas to attract customers. These stores offer a wide range of chocolates, caramel apples, fudge, and other confections to cater to different customer preferences. Franchise-operated stores follow the same business model and product offerings, ensuring consistency across all locations.

Online Sales: RMCF utilizes its official website as a channel for online sales. Customers can browse through the product offerings, place orders, and have the items delivered to their doorstep. The online platform allows for convenience and accessibility, especially for customers who are unable to visit physical stores.

Third-Party Retailers: In addition to company-owned and franchise-operated stores, Rocky Mountain Chocolate Factory, Inc. also distributes its products through third-party retailers and specialty stores. By partnering with other businesses, the company is able to expand its reach and make its products available to a wider customer base.

Cost Structure


The cost structure of Rocky Mountain Chocolate Factory, Inc. (RMCF) is made up of various components that are essential for the operation and growth of the business. These costs include:

  • Cost of goods sold: This includes the cost of ingredients and production materials used in creating the delicious chocolates and treats that RMCF is known for. It is crucial for RMCF to ensure that the quality of ingredients is high while also keeping costs at a manageable level to maintain profitability.
  • Store operation costs: RMCF operates numerous stores across various locations, each requiring rent, utilities, and staffing. These operational costs are necessary for running the day-to-day activities of the business and providing a welcoming environment for customers.
  • Franchise support and development costs: RMCF offers franchise opportunities to individuals who want to open their own chocolate stores under the RMCF brand. To support these franchisees and help them succeed, RMCF incurs costs related to training, marketing support, and ongoing assistance.
  • Marketing and advertising expenses: In order to attract customers and drive sales, RMCF invests in marketing and advertising efforts. This includes digital marketing, social media campaigns, and other promotional activities to reach a wider audience and increase brand awareness.

Revenue Streams


The revenue streams for Rocky Mountain Chocolate Factory, Inc. (RMCF) are diverse and come from various sources. These revenue streams include:

  • Sales from company-owned stores: One of the main revenue streams for RMCF is sales from its company-owned stores. Customers visit these stores to purchase a wide range of chocolate products such as truffles, fudge, caramel apples, and more. These sales contribute significantly to the company's overall revenue.
  • Franchise fees and royalties: RMCF also generates revenue through franchise fees and royalties from its franchisees. Franchisees pay an initial fee to open a store under the RMCF brand, and they also pay ongoing royalties based on their sales. This revenue stream allows RMCF to expand its presence without investing heavily in new store openings.
  • Online sales revenue: With the rise of e-commerce, RMCF has tapped into the online sales market. Customers can order chocolate products from the company's website and have them delivered to their doorstep. This revenue stream has become increasingly important, especially during times when physical stores may be closed or operating at limited capacity.
  • Seasonal and promotional product sales: RMCF generates additional revenue through seasonal and promotional product sales. During holidays such as Valentine's Day, Easter, Halloween, and Christmas, the company offers special chocolate products that cater to the festive spirit. These limited-time offerings attract customers and drive sales, helping boost overall revenue.
